Summary:
The Preschool Teacher Assistant supports the Preschool Teacher in delivering a high-quality, developmentally appropriate early childhood education program. Under the supervision of the Director of Early Childhood Services, this role assists with lesson planning, child assessments, and classroom management, while fostering a safe, clean, and engaging environment that promotes children’s cognitive, social, emotional, and physical growth. The Preschool Teacher Assistant builds positive relationships with children, parents, and staff, maintains accurate records, and ensures compliance with Ibero policies and NYSOCFS regulations.

- Report directly to the Director of Early Childhood Services.
- Establish and maintain positive working relationships with Ibero staff, partner agencies, and parents.
- Assist the Preschool Teacher in planning and implementing a developmentally appropriate curriculum.
- Conduct initial assessments of children to evaluate progress and adjust educational plans as needed.
- Communicate regularly with parents regarding their child’s development and progress.
- Help organize and maintain a clean, safe, and inviting classroom environment.
- Prepare the learning environment to promote children’s cognitive, social, emotional, and physical growth.
- Adhere to Ibero’s policies, procedures, and NYSOCFS regulations.
- Maintain attendance records, weekly lesson plans, and other required documentation.
- Notify the Head Teacher and Director of any parent concerns.
- Foster a positive self-image in children through an atmosphere of love, trust, and positive guidance.
- Always supervise and ensure the safety of all children.
- Coordinate and support special activities and field trips.
- Assist with minor cleaning duties as assigned by the Head Teacher or Director.
- Report any classroom maintenance or repair needs to the Director.
- Complete assigned tasks in a timely manner.
- Participate in scheduled staff meetings, parent meetings, staff training, and center events.
- Maintain confidentiality regarding all children and families.
- Engage in ongoing professional development.
- Perform other duties as assigned by the Director of Early Childhood Services.

Requirements
Qualifications:
Education & Experience
- High School Diploma required, College Degree preferred.
- Child Development Associate (CDA) certification strongly preferred.
- Knowledge of child development, early childhood education principles, and positive discipline techniques.
- Bilingual in English and Spanish required.
- Experience working with infants, toddlers, or preschool-aged children.
- Must have clearance through NYS Central Registry, good police record and health.
- Reliable transportation required.
- Must be COVID vaccinated.
- Must obtain a physical exam w/TB test, fingerprinting, and State Clearance.
- A combination of training and experience other than the specified, if judged to be adequate for the job, may be accepted by the President and CEO.
The position does require occasional standing, squatting, and lifting up to approximately 40 lbs. and frequent sitting.
